    The OFT cannot take on individual cases, that's the FOS's job. The OFT will however, register the complaint and compile a case against a company who breach OFT requirements on debt collection. A simple letter giving brief details of your complaint will cost pennies. But, keep it brief and invite them to contact you for more info if required. Don't go into a verble diatribe about your thought's and opinions, they don't have the time for personal stuff.

    UPDATE ON THE NEW LETTER

    I have received this yesterday and knowing what a bunch of pr**** they are, i laugh at each letter. They make it sound like they are already doing something, but in the reality it is another intimidating, cleverly worded letter that should make you believe that you are in trouble and soon you will end up in court. A lot of crap!

    Here is one more letter to my collection

    "DEFAULT ON FIXED SUM LOAN AGREEMENT REGULATED BY THE CONSUMER CREDIT ACT 1974

    Application for a County Court Judgment.

    We act for MacKenzie Hall Debt Purchases Ltd who as you will be aware acquired the above account from Quick Quid.

    Since you have not made payment to the account, we will have no option but to take legal Action against you.

    TAKE NOTICE that unless the account is paid in full (still trying to get the money, even though they are still claiming incorrect balance!), or your reasonable proposals for settlement are received within 7 days (I offered them the setllement figure and the guy from Mucky Hall responded by almost laughing in my face!) then legal proceedings shall be issued against you in the County Court for recovery of the full amount outstanding. The proceedings will include additional claims for legal costs and interest which will increase the amount that you will be required to pay.

    In the event that judgment is obtained against you then it will be entered in a public register, the Register of Judgments, Orders and Fines. The details will then be passed to credit reference agencies, who will supply them to credit grantors and others seeking information on your financial standing. This will make it difficult for you to get credit.

    We will also be instructed to enforce any judgment that is obtained against you. This could result in the court bailiff being instructed under a warrant of execution to seize and sell your goods (I have nothing that belongs to me! All belongs to my boyfriend or landlord, so they can do nothing to me!), or your employer being ordered to make deductions from your salary, or charge being placed on your property to the value of the debt.

    Your payment must be sent to our clients address shown below. etc etc etc "

    As you can see it is 3rd or 4th letter i have received from them and each time they give me another 7 days to pay off the balance and each time they threaten me with court and other actions. I would actually love to meet them in court and prove to the judge that the balance is incorrect, that i tried to make a reasonable arrangement to pay it off, but I was being ignored, or being treated rudely by the Mucky Hall Customer Service. Considering OFT is already investigating Mucky Hall practise, I would love to see what the judge would say to them about it. ))

    Hope that people who are in similar situation will read all those letters and realise that there is nothing to worry about. Do not call them back, do not respond to their letters and do not panic. If it comes to worse and you will have to face them in person, you have amazing lawyers from Legal Beagle who can advice you what to do.
